How to be a Better Listener in a Relationship – 10 Best Ways
In my previous articles on ‘relationship tips,’ I have written a few articles on ‘how to build trust in a relationship,’ ‘how to make your relationship last longer,’ and several more. I have always focused on one key element in all my relationship tips, i.e., “communication.” Communication is indeed an essential foundation in a relationship. But when we say communication, it doesn’t mean only talking. Communication can be of two ways: talking and listening. For a healthy and long-lasting relationship, both talking and listening are equally important. 10 Best Ways to Deal with One-Sided Love
Have you ever dealt with one-sided love or unrequited love? What is unrequited love? When you have strong romantic feelings towards someone, but he/she doesn’t reciprocate, your love is unrequited love. In laymen’s terms, we call it ‘one-sided love’ – love that is not returned or got reciprocated. It is a disheartening experience for those who have to deal with it. Truth to be told, love is a beautiful feeling, but only when two persons accept each other and feel the emotion for each other. How safe are you when dating online?
(This is guest Post and the content doesn’t include any affiliate links. All links are informational) Image from Pixabay.com The internet transformed the world into one global village. Communicating with people across the globe became much easier at the click of a mouse. The Covid-19 pandemic and the lockdowns across the world saw a rise in online communication and dating. Most dating sites experienced phenomenal growth, and between March and May this year, apps such as OkCupid experienced a 700% date increase, while Bumble had a 70% spike in video calls.
